Rx. Astragali Huang Qi 9-30g Tonifies Qi and Blood.
Rz. Chuanxiong Chuan Xiong 3-10g Invigorates the Blood and promotes the movement of Qi.
Rx. Salviae Miltiorrhizae Dan Shen 3-15g Invigorates the Blood, dispels Blood Stasis, clears Heat, soothes irritability, cools and nourishes the Blood and calms the Spirit.
Rx. Paeoniae Rubra Chi Shao 4.5-15g Invigorates the Blood, dispels Blood Stasis, relieves pain, clears Heat and cools the Blood.
  • Tonifies Qi and Blood
  • Invigorates the Blood
  • Dispels Blood Stasis
  • Promotes the movement of Qi
  • Clears Heat
  • Cools the Blood
  • Blood Stagnation with Qi and Blood Deficiency with Heat
  • Palpitations
  • Stabbing pain in the anterior region over the Heart
  • Suffocating sensation in chest
  • Maybe drawing pain down internal aspect of arm (especially the left arm)
  • Pain (in the chest and/or arm) tends to be severe and intermittent
  • Easily startled
  • Insomnia
  • Fatigue
  • Spontaneous sweating
  • Much dreaming
  • Fever
  • Perspiration
  • Irritability
  • Restlessness
  • Dry mouth
  • Thirst
  • Dry throat
  • T: Dark red with purple spots or Purple body or Red and dry
  • C: Little or None
  • P: Hasty or Choppy and rapid
